Driving directions from Blaine Lake to Clyde

Real distance: 553.1 km  ·  Estimated time: 6 h 27 min

🗓 Calculated on June 4, 2026
  1. Drive northeast on 4 Avenue. 140 m
  2. Turn right onto Main Street/12. 167 m
  3. Turn right onto Highway 40/40. 99.7 km
  4. Turn right onto 16/40/Yellowhead Route. 760 m
  5. Keep left to stay on 16/40. 4.0 km
  6. Keep right to stay on 16 toward Lloydminster. 133.5 km
  7. Turn left onto 40 Avenue. 3.2 km
  8. Turn right onto 12 Street. 5.0 km
  9. Turn right onto 75 Avenue. 3.3 km
  10. Turn left onto 16/Ray Nelson Drive. Continue on 16. 165.7 km
  11. Turn right onto 15/855. 2.1 km
  12. Turn left onto 49 Avenue/15. Continue on 15. 34.4 km
